Housing and Weather Effects

Much of the housing in Largo dates back to the 1970s, with roofing materials from that era requiring attention over time. Pinellas County, where Largo is located, has experienced 53 damaging wind events in the last decade and two hurricanes nearby since 2000, including Hurricane Milton in 2024. These conditions contribute to common roofing concerns such as weakened shingles, storm-related damage, and water intrusion issues.

Choosing Repairs or Replacement

Largo homeowners decide between repairing damage and replacing entire roofs based on the extent of wear and material condition. Small leaks and localized damage often favor repairs, while widespread deterioration or multiple material failures suggest replacement. Considering material types and roof age helps inform this choice.

Scheduling a roof inspection every few years helps identify issues before they worsen. After strong storms or sustained high winds, an additional check is advisable. Regular inspections assist in maintaining roof integrity and prolonging its service life.

Asphalt shingles, metal roofing, and tile are commonly used. Each has advantages related to durability, appearance, and local climate tolerance. Your choice depends on budget, home style, and how much maintenance you prefer.

Look for missing or cracked shingles, water stains on ceilings, or visible damage after storms. Soft spots on the roof deck and moss growth are also signs that repairs may be needed. Professional inspections provide a thorough condition assessment.

The process begins with removing old materials, inspecting the deck, and repairing any damage. New roofing materials are installed carefully with attention to fasteners and seals. Work sites are cleaned daily, and final inspections confirm completion.

Yes, proper ventilation reduces attic heat buildup in summer and moisture accumulation in winter. This lowers energy costs, prevents damage to roofing materials, and helps maintain more stable indoor temperatures.
